This finding aid is a partial inventory to the 136-box collection of the Alexis Carrel Papers and a result of the consolidation of two smaller Carrel collections. Materials in the collection largely deal with Carrel’s main subjects of study: cancer and tumor studies, organ transplantation, blood transfusion, and various environmental and diet research done on mice to study sarcoma and other cancers.
